st/mesa: add st fp64 support (v7.1)

This adds support to the state tracker for
ARB_gpu_shader_fp64.

The details are explained in comments
within the code.

v2 : add double to int/unsigned conversion
v3: handle fp64 consts better
v4: use DRSQ
v4.1: add d2b
v4.2: drop DDIV

v5: split out some prep patches.
v5.1: add some comments.
v5.2: more comments

v6: simplify down the double instruction
    generation loop.

v7: Merge Ilia's two cleanup patches.
v7.1: minor fixups for Ilia patch + cleanups

+   /*
+    * This section contains the double processing.
+    * GLSL just represents doubles as single channel values,
+    * however most HW and TGSI represent doubles as pairs of register channels.
+    *
+    * so we have to fixup destination writemask/index and src swizzle/indexes.
+    * dest writemasks need to translate from single channel write mask
+    * to a dual-channel writemask, but also need to modify the index,
+    * if we are touching the Z,W fields in the pre-translated writemask.
+    *
+    * src channels have similiar index modifications along with swizzle
+    * changes to we pick the XY, ZW pairs from the correct index.
+    *
+    * GLSL [0].x -> TGSI [0].xy
+    * GLSL [0].y -> TGSI [0].zw
+    * GLSL [0].z -> TGSI [1].xy
+    * GLSL [0].w -> TGSI [1].zw
+    */
